A licence for a person does not permit the individual's company or partnership to make the agreement, also if the individual is a supervisor of the company or participant of the collaboration. If the company or partnership is making the contract, the business or collaboration requires to be licensed in the company or partnership name.

These warranties are: the work will certainly be carried out with due care and also skillthe work will be in accordance with any type of plans as well as requirements laid out in the contractall products provided will certainly appropriate for the function for which they are to be usedmaterials will certainly be brand-new, unless otherwise specifiedthe work will be carried out in conformity to, and will adhere to, the Residence Structure Act 1989 or any kind of various other lawthe job will certainly be performed with due diligence and within the time stated in the agreement, or otherwise in a reasonable timethe job will certainly cause a house that is fairly fit to live in, if the job includes: building and construction of a dwellingmaking of alterations or enhancements to a dwellingrepairing, restoration, design or protective therapy of a dwellingthe work as well as any products utilized in doing the work will certainly be sensibly suitabled for the defined purpose or result that the proprietor has advised the service provider, while showing that the proprietor relies upon the service provider's skill and also judgment.

The House Building Act 1989 has a clear definition of what is meant by 'conclusion'. Residential structure job is 'total' when it matches the needs of the agreement. If there is no contract, or the contract doesn't specify 'conclusion', the work is considered as 'full' when it can be made use of for its desired purpose and also is devoid of significant issues.

Select installations and also home appliances before you authorize a contract.

Where possible, checklist the brand and also designs of all installations, tiles, appliances, etc that you desire used. While it is best to obtain a set price for all work under a contract, specific fixtures such as an oven or unique fittings might need to be selected after you authorize the contract.



The building contractor or tradesperson must allow a price, which covers their expected price. For smaller sized tasks, such as altering a powerpoint or uncloging a pipeline, it's not likely you'll be asked to pay a deposit. For larger work, where a big element of the price is in the materials, the builder or tradesperson may request for a down payment.
